Intergener8 Living Lab

Intergener8 Living Lab is a co-research and co-design entity working with over 100 industry, government, civil society and academic stakeholders to develop technology-based strategies to nurture intergenerational resilience.

 

Intergener8 has four key pillars:

  1. Intergenerational. Our focus is on young people but we take an intergenerational approach to strengthening individual and community resilience.
  2. Place-based and Translatable. Western Sydney, the fastest growing and most diverse region in Australia, struggles with social, cultural and economic inequality and ecological challenges. Common to other urban settings, they mean the learnings from Intergener8 can be translated to national and international settings.
  3. Digital. We both develop develop technology-based strategies for resilience, and understand the digital more generally as an influence shaping our ways of being online and offline, a setting for transformation rather than a solution in itself.
  4. Ongoing and iterative. Through continuous facilitation, we empower our community to generate, analyse and utilise meaningful data via a unique co-research and engagement Toolkit.

Imagining the Green Cities of the Future: Global Cases – Workshop

Thursday, 14 Mar 2024
Online
This is a role-play where each participant will embody a key figure in society. Together, we will collaboratively craft strategies aimed at fostering a sustainable future by envisioning the world in 2050. The focus lies on various cities worldwide, each poised for a green transition. Through dialogue and negotiation, the aim is to forge agreements that pave the way for necessary actions and initiatives.
